private void DetailSizeCheckBoxActionPerformed(
      java.awt.event.ActionEvent evt) { // GEN-FIRST:event_DetailSizeCheckBoxActionPerformed
    if (!DetailSizeCheckBox.isSelected()) {
      // select the volume checkbox
      VolumeCheckBox.setSelected(true);

      // enable the volume text field
      VolumeTF.setEnabled(true);
      VolumeLabel.setText("* Volume : ");

      // disable the detail of size text field
      LengthTF.setText("");
      LengthTF.setEnabled(false);
      LengthLabel.setText("Length : ");
      WidthTF.setText("");
      WidthTF.setEnabled(false);
      WidthLabel.setText("Width : ");
      HeightTF.setText("");
      HeightTF.setEnabled(false);
      HeightLabel.setText("Height : ");
    } else {
      // dis-select the volume checkbox
      VolumeCheckBox.setSelected(false);
      VolumeLabel.setText("Volume : ");

      // empty the volume text field and disable it
      VolumeTF.setText("");
      VolumeTF.setEnabled(false);

      // reenable the detail of size text field
      LengthTF.setEnabled(true);
      LengthLabel.setText("* Length : ");
      WidthTF.setEnabled(true);
      WidthLabel.setText("* Width : ");
      HeightTF.setEnabled(true);
      HeightLabel.setText("* Height : ");
    }
  } // GEN-LAST:event_DetailSizeCheckBoxActionPerformed